Murphy talks about 82 games: No NBA players want to reduce because we don t want to lose money
Recently, Pelicans player Trey Murphy talked about 82 regular season games in the "The Young Man And The Three" podcast.
Murphy said: "First of all, no NBA players would say they want to reduce the game because it's about money, and we don't want to lose our money. But I would say it's too hard back-to-back, especially from one city to another. I clearly remember that in the third year of my career, we played in New York, then we played the Pacers, and we arrived in Indiana the next morning, but we were going to play at 7pm."
